This wedding day began quietly and personally in Wiesbaden. The getting ready took place at home, in a relaxed and familiar atmosphere. These early moments set the tone for a day full of emotion, connection and celebration.
Church ceremony in Wiesbaden-Naurod and Couple Shoot at Schloss Johannisberg
The couple said their vows during a church ceremony at the Protestant church in Wiesbaden. The ceremony was emotional and meaningful, surrounded by family and friends. It was a moment of reflection, warmth and shared joy that marked the heart of the day.
After the ceremony, we headed to Schloss Johannisberg for the couple shoot. The historic building, the surrounding vineyards and the soft summer light created a calm and timeless setting. The shoot felt natural and unforced, allowing the couple to enjoy time together before the evening celebration.
The celebration took place at Brentanoscheune in Oestrich-Winkel, located between castles and vineyards. The venue offered a warm and welcoming atmosphere for a lively summer celebration.
Traditional elements from both cultures came together in a joyful and relaxed way, creating a feeling of unity and openness throughout the evening.
As a wedding photographer and videographer, I captured the real emotions, the cultural connection and the energy of the celebration in images and film. Every moment told the story of two people, two families and two cultures coming together on a beautiful summer day.
